Listing Cell Processor and Memory Configurations

Using the BCH interface, you can check these details only for the active
cells in the local partition.
Step 1. Access the BCH interface for the partition to which the cell is assigned,
and access the BCH Information menu.
From the BCH Main menu, enter IN to access the BCH Information
menu. (If you are not at the BCH Main menu, enter MA to go to the Main
menu.)
Step 2. From the BCH Information menu, list the processor or memory status
for all cells by issuing the PR and ME commands.
Processor status—Use the PR command to report details about all
processors on all active cells in the partition.
Memory status—Use the ME command to report details about all
active cells’ memory configurations.
The ME command summarizes memory (DIMM) details for each ranks
of memory. Each rank is a set of 4 DIMMs.
These BCH commands do not report details for inactive cells.
